Output 81aab157713c30eae9dcfac81601eb23b2514b6cf1595c462ad2c67658b4fa37:1

value
131000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96881f9523d5cc97497b37f9c52807ef4d009dc7 OP_EQUALVERIFY OP_CHECKSIG
address
1EiwRnwZk6tyJNbWg2CUAqyVMNWpTVCTt8
transaction
81aab157713c30eae9dcfac81601eb23b2514b6cf1595c462ad2c67658b4fa37
confirmations
525919
spent
true